GABC vs HSBC: Which Is the Better Dividend Stock?

As of July 2026, GABC (German American Bancorp, Inc.) screens as the stronger dividend stock, winning 5 of 8 head-to-head metrics. HSBC offers the higher yield at 3.63%, GABC has the higher dividend-safety score, and GABC trades at the larger discount to fair value (+61%).

MetricGABCHSBC
Forward yield2.48%3.63%
Annual dividend$1.20$3.75
Payout ratio32%62%
Years of growth13 yr0 yr
5-yr dividend growth8.8%-13.8%
5-yr total return30%291%
Dividend safety score99 (A)70 (B)
Fair value estimate$77.87$126.29
Upside to fair value+61%+22%
Frequencyquarterlyquarterly
Market cap$1.8B$354.6B
P/E ratio13.317.1
